MARYVILLE, TENNESSEE – Blount County Sheriff James Lee Berrong regretfully announces that the Sheriff’s Office, along with members of Blount County’s Fire Investigation Review Team, is investigating a residential fire in which three people died [Friday] morning.
At approximately 7:15 this morning, Sheriff’s deputies, along with the Blount County Fire Department, responded to a residence in the 4800 block of Sevierville Road to the report of a fire. When deputies and firefighters arrived, they found the main part of the house engulfed in flames. Firefighters quickly knocked down the flames and began their search for victims. Firefighters located three victims inside of the residence. The victims were taken by AMR Ambulance Service to area hospitals. All three victims succumbed to their injuries and were pronounced dead at the hospital.
The Blount County Fire Department arrived on the scene in less than five minutes after the call was dispatched. There were 14 firefighters and eight fire trucks on the scene.
